Steps to Ship Biological Samples with FedEx International:

1. Check regulations and guidelines:

Before shipping biological samples, it is essential to check the regulations and guidelines of both the origin and destination countries. You can find this information on the FedEx website or by contacting your local FedEx office.

2. Prepare necessary documentation:

You will need accurate documentation to accompany your shipment of biological samples. This documentation may include:

  • Commercial Invoice: This should include a description of the sample, its value, and the intended use.
  • Packing List: This should list all items included in the shipment.
  • Shipper's Declaration for Dangerous Goods: This is required for all shipments of biological samples classified as hazardous materials.
  • Certificate of Analysis: This may be required for certain types of biological samples.

3. Properly package your samples:

Biological samples must be packaged correctly to ensure their safety and stability during transit. You can find packaging guidelines on the FedEx website or by contacting your local FedEx office.

4. Schedule pickup or drop-off at FedEx:

You can schedule a pickup or drop off your biological samples at the nearest FedEx office.

5. Track your shipment:

You can track the shipment of your biological samples on the FedEx website or using the FedEx Mobile app.

Tips for Shipping Biological Samples with FedEx International

  • Use sturdy and airtight packaging.
  • Use absorbents to prevent leaks.
  • Freeze biological samples if necessary.
  • Clearly and accurately label the samples.
  • Keep required documentation securely.
